Position: Strategic Bomber Subject Matter Expert (SME)
Location: Offutt AFB, NE
Position Overview
The Strategic Bomber Subject Matter Expert (SME) provides senior-level expertise on U.S. strategic bomber operations in direct support of United States Strategic Command (USSTRATCOM) Joint Exercises, Training, and Assessment (J7) missions. This role serves as the authoritative advisor on bomber force capabilities, employment concepts, and operational integration across the nuclear triad.
Key Responsibilities
- Conduct advanced analysis of USSTRATCOM core mission areas with emphasis on strategic bomber operations, posture, and employment.
- Provide subject matter expertise on bomber platforms including B-1, B-2, B-52, and B-21.
- Assess strategic deterrence effectiveness and integration of bomber capabilities within nuclear and conventional operations.
- Support development and execution of joint exercises, training events, and assessments in accordance with JELC processes.
- Contribute to operational planning efforts, including campaign plans, CONOPS, OPORDs, and strategic assessments.
- Advise senior leadership on bomber force readiness, capability gaps, and operational risks.
- Integrate bomber operations within broader NC2/NC3 frameworks and global strike missions.
- Participate in wargaming, scenario development, and after-action analysis.
- Coordinate across Joint Staff, Combatant Commands, Services, and interagency partners.
Required Qualifications
- Minimum 15 years of practical experience with B-1, B-2, B-52, and/or B-21 bomber operations as a commissioned officer.
- Minimum 3 years of experience at the Office of the Secretary of Defense, Joint Staff, Combatant Command, Service, MAJCOM, or equivalent headquarters-level organization.
- Master's degree or higher from an accredited institution.
- Joint Professional Military Education (JPME) Phase II graduate .
- Senior Service School graduate (e.g., Air War College, Naval War College, Army War College, or equivalent).
- Weapons School graduate (e.g., USAF Weapons School or equivalent).
- Demonstrated Air Operations Center (AOC) experience, including planning and execution of air operations.
- Active Top Secret/SCI clearance with eligibility for:
- NC2/ESI access
- Special Access Programs (SAP)
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ience supporting USSTRATCOM J7 or similar Joint training and assessment environments.
- Deep understanding of nuclear command, control, and communications (NC3) and global strike operations.
- Experience with strategic deterrence assessments and campaign analysis.
- Familiarity with Joint Exercise Life Cycle (JELC), Joint Training Information Management System (JTIMS), and Joint Training Toolkit (JTT).
- Prior experience supporting senior-level decision-making and strategic planning processes.
